The first one-hundred pages of Giacomo Leopardi’s Zibaldone follow an organisation that differs from the structure held by the rest of the book. First of all, they are numbered but not dated. Secondly, their organisation is seemingly chaotic, though they proceed according a rigorous argumentation. The argumentative discourse is mostly structured around two cognitive modalities: following an analogical principle and proceeding through logical gaps connected by metaphors.
